    Deakin University was formally established in 1974 with the passage of the Deakin University Act 1974. [24] Deakin was Victoria's fourth university, the first to be established in regional Victoria and the first to specialise in distance education. [citation needed] Deakin University's first campus was established at Waurn Ponds.

    The Deakin University Elite Sports Precinct is a series of sports venues located on the campus of Deakin University in Waurn Ponds, Victoria.The precinct's Australian rules football oval is used as a training facility by the Geelong Football Club's Australian Football League (AFL) and AFL Women's (AFLW) teams, and as a secondary home ground by its VFL Women's (VFLW) team.
